processing time on USCIS is not an estimate but is based on what they approved in last 6 months (it was 1 month some time ago). USCIS publishes 50 and 93 percentiles of request processed by them. Now you can use it for future estimate but the problem is that requests/application are not spread around every month equally. Therefore it can be wrong but that's the best number available to us officially.
